Chemistry
Associate in Arts (DTA) or Associate of Science (Track 1)
Chemistry is the science which studies matter, its properties and composition, and the laws that govern the formation of matter from the basic elements. The breadth of the subject area is enormous and chemists can be found working on such diverse problems as the development of new plastics and fibers, drug preparation, pollution control, the isolation and identification of plant and insect hormones, medical research, nuclear chemistry, and the analysis of geological materials.
